How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Carnation?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Carnation Studio Apartments | $1,907 | $1,198 | $2,340 |
| Carnation 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,305 | $1,263 | $4,715 |
Carnation 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,119 | $1,509 | $6,150 |
| Carnation 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,817 | $1,725 | $4,960 |
| Carnation 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,492 | $2,400 | $2,600 |

Cheapest Available Carnation and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 27, 2026 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Carnation, WA is the Plan 2B Model starting from $2,167 at Vesta in the Southeast Redmond neighborhood. The second most affordable Carnation 2 Bedroom is the The Cedar Model at The Trails of Redmond starting at $2,237 in the Crossroads ne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Carnation is currently $3,119.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Carnation: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Vesta | Plan 2B | $2,167 |
| The Trails of Redmond | The Cedar | $2,237 |
| Sunset Apartments | 2bedroom / 1 bath top | $2,350 |
| The Colony at Bear Creek | 2 Bed + 2 Bath | $2,399 |
| Summerwalk at Klahanie | Safflower | $2,495 |
| Redmond Hill | Plan 2D | $2,559 |
| Avalon at Bear Creek | B1 | $2,665 |
| Vue Issaquah | Cedar | $2,678 |
| The Knolls at Inglewood Hill | Hillside | $2,750 |
| Discovery West | Warhol | $2,769 |
